The ANA test is also known as FANA (Fluorescent Antinuclear Antibody) and Antinuclear Antibody Panel, and is generally prescribed for symptoms such as:
- Changes in skin colour
- Recurring fever, fatigue
- Muscle and joint pain
- Joint swelling or stiffness
- Butterfly-shaped rashes on the cheeks and nose bridge
Some of the autoimmune conditions that the ANA test detects are:
- Polymyositis
- Dermatomyositis
- Systemic lupus erythematosus
- Addison’s disease
- Sjogren’s syndrome
- Raynaud’s phenomenon
- Rheumatoid arthritis
- Scleroderma
Test Necessity
The ANA test enables the assessment of the amount of antinuclear antibodies in the blood (titer) and their specific pattern. This ensures that early signs of health problems like autoimmune diseases and viral infections are detected. It also enables timely intervention to prevent their progression. If the ANA test result is positive, further blood tests can be carried out to check for specific antinuclear antibodies linked to certain diseases. Antinuclear antibodies can also be related to infectious diseases, cancers, and specific medications.
Test Preparation
No special preparation is required for the ANA test. However, it's important to let your doctor know if you're currently taking any medications, as certain pills can influence the test results. So, ensure that your doctor is pre-informed of your medical history and current medication plans.

What is the normal ANA level?
A normal ANA level typically ranges between 1:40 and 1:60. You can find the specific range and more details on your blood test report.
What happens if the ANA test is positive?
When the ANA levels are high, it signals the presence of an underlying autoimmune disease, a viral infection, or another health condition that causes elevated ANA. However, it is also important to note that a positive result does not necessarily suggest the presence of an underlying autoimmune condition, and further testing may be required.
